Oxetane Biphenyl for Optoelectronics: Properties and Sourcing Guide
The rapid advancements in optoelectronics demand novel materials with specific, high-performance characteristics. Oxetane Biphenyl, identified by CAS number 358365-48-7, is emerging as a compound of significant interest in this field. Its inherent properties, including good solubility and thermal stability, position it as a valuable component for researchers and developers aiming to create next-generation organic optoelectronic devices.
As a supplier of specialized fine chemicals, we understand the critical role that purity and consistency play in optoelectronic research. Oxetane Biphenyl, often supplied with an assay of ≥97.0%, is utilized not only as a reaction intermediate in organic synthesis but also for its potential as a photosensitizer or a direct material component in devices like OLEDs and organic solar cells. Its molecular structure allows for tailored electronic and optical properties.
